CHM 331 - Analytical ChemistryFour Credits Fall Semester 2013 (Spring Semester starting in 2014)
This course provides an in-depth study of chemical equilibrium in acid-base, complexation, oxidation-reduction and precipitation reactions, as well as incorporates a survey of analytical instrumentation. Quantitative analysis methods, including titrations, spectroscopy, chromatography, and potentiometry, are discussed and performed with rigorous statistical evaluation of experimental data in a 4-hour weekly laboratory session.
Prerequisite(s): CHM 222 . Fulfills the Statistical Reasoning requirement.
